ECAHLI Foundation (a Dutch Stichting, currently in the process of registration), based in Asunción, Paraguay, sits above ECAHLI Global Holdings, which oversees Node Leadership and Community Self-Governance at each site. A Nairobi HQ is being established as the platform's dedicated Africa regional base. The Global Holdings Board currently holds three seats filled by founding directors, with four reserved for future institutional and strategic partners.

| Node | Location | Status | What's confirmed |
|---|---|---|---|
| Tsavo Eco Reserve | Tsavo, Kenya | Active Development | 100 hectares. Phase 1: 50 homes, 10 founder lots, airstrip, eco-lodge and adventure park components. |
| Tiwi Bay | Kenya coast | Active Development | 25-acre beachfront site. Full financial model currently being finalised. |
| Malindi Ngomeni | Kenya coast | Active Development | 74 acres of freehold coastline. Full financial model currently being finalised. |
| Kisumu African Flagship | Kisumu, Kenya | In Planning | Verified v30 base case: Y5 revenue $42.8M, 41.5% EBITDA margin, 16.5% equity IRR, 3.65× MOIC, 395 direct jobs at Year 5. |
| Brazil Flagship | Goiás State, Brazil | Development Commencing Q3 2027 | 250 hectares secured (100 further hectares in negotiation). Verified v19 model: 27.4% base equity IRR, 68.0% EBITDA margin, 8.47× DSCR. |
| Paraguay 2025 | Colmena District, Paraguay | Development Commencing Q2 2027 | Founding node concept. Financial model currently being reconciled across versions before figures are published. |
